Update on 2015 RB Jordan Stevenson after the Texas Stampede (24/7). He's no longer at Dallas Skyline, he's now at Dallas South Oak Cliff:
“Basically the visit was a great deal,” Stevenson said. “There were so many top recruits there and we all had the best time. It was just a real fun day. Our parents did their own thing while we did ours. We hung out with the coaches a lot, which I loved. We got to do a lot of bowling with them and had that chance to really connect with them. We also got to do a lot of other great things, like meet the president of the University of Texas and meet all the staff. That stood out a lot to me.”
“I really got a vibe and got a personal feel for Texas,” said Stevenson. “That vibe about the school I got was strong, real strong actually. I won’t lie; Texas caught my eye with this visit. I already was before, but now I’m looking very closely at them. I enjoyed it. It was an outstanding visit.”
“They’re definitely there,” he said. “I’m thinking highly of them, higher than ever before. They have a lot to offer not only for athletics, but for academics too. I’m really feeling that vibe and I’m feeling strongly about their academics. I can picture myself being a Longhorn without a doubt."
“If you look at it, they’re the best school in the state when it comes to a combination of football and academics together. No other can offer what they do,” he added. “Some come close, but they’re the best when you combine academics and football.”
“Larry Porter is one of my favorite coaches now,” said Stevenson. “He’s very down to earth. He has a great heart and is a great coach. He told me something that really stuck with me too. He said ‘Don’t let the game of football use you. You use game of football to achieve your goals and to get your degree.' I loved that because that fits me."
“He also says he has a great vision to make me the best running back I can be,” he added. “He’s very positive and inspiring. I love that about him.”
“It depends on the cir stances (when he decides to commit),” Stevenson said. “Right now I'm praying on it. I’m thinking a lot about schools, especially Texas, after that visit. It could happen anytime really. I’m just taking it step by step.”
